xWELL: Portable governance across chains

Moonwell's solution hinges on the xERC20 token standard, branded as xWELL, which treats the token as a single, portable asset regardless of which chain it sits on. This eliminates the fragmentation problems that arise when tokens are wrapped differently across networks.

Community proposals leading to the xERC20 upgrade began in early 2024, specifically aimed at eliminating the complications from wrapped token implementations on different chains. The shift represents a structural change to how Moonwell's governance operates at scale.

How governance works on Moonwell

Governance on Moonwell operates through Moonwell Improvement Proposals, or MIPs. These are the formal mechanism through which the community proposes changes, votes on them, and executes results on-chain.

Holders who want voting power can stake their WELL tokens in Moonwell's Safety Module, receiving stkWELL in return. Stakers face slashing risks of up to 30% in shortfall events, meaning if the protocol suffers a significant loss, staked tokens can be partially liquidated to cover protocol deficits.

Recent governance milestones

The most notable recent development is MIP-X55, which was approved following a vote that ran from May 13 to May 16. This vote connected the Ethereum mainnet to the xWELL bridge, expanding the protocol's reach.

Following MIP-X55, the protocol is pursuing MIP-X58, which aims to streamline governance activity directly within the Ethereum ecosystem, reducing steps and friction involved in participating. These incremental improvements reflect Moonwell's focus on making multichain governance more accessible.
